Abstract
We prove an analogue of Scholze's Primitive Comparison Theorem for proper rigid spaces over an algebraically closed non-archimedean field of characteristic . This implies a v-topological version of the Primitive Comparison Theorem for proper finite type morphisms of analytic adic spaces over . We deduce new cases of the Proper Base Change Theorem for -torsion coefficients and the Künneth formula in this setting.
